The stock MS Port Moresby, like many of the other stock fields, is in the wrong location and looks nothing remotely like the real field. Beyond it being just plain ugly it was also in the way. It had to go, and to tell the truth I was glad to eradicate it.
In the READ_ME file it states that... " Also included are BGL's to correct the Landclass of the Port Moresby Area and remove the Stock MS Port Moresby Airfield." There’s also a warning about the GSL Scenery GOB’s being overwritten and the changes for the airbases.dat file in the Installation Section.
Old missions can be edited with ease to use the correct fields and with the “Fully Loaded” Layout files that I included enhancing those missions can also be done in a snap.
With all 6 of the real PM Primary Airdromes I saw no reason to preserve it and to be honest I find it hard to understand why anyone would want it or any other stock field back when it has been replaced with a true, historical reproduction(s). The same thing was done with the stock Wewak and soon to be released Cape Gloucester and many more will follow. They're in the wrong place and personally I can't stand the big brown blobs. That's the reason I've taken the time and effort to learn Land Class creation, to rid the sim of them and replace them with historically correct Field Locations, Land Class Textures and Layouts.
BTW, The area where the Port Moresby Dromes were built is not a solid Jungle, it's mostly grass land and swamp with sparse trees and dense patches of trees scattered about. If some custom texture set switched the LC of a particular texture series from the defined standards don't blame the LC.bgl...
